Manometric demonstration of duodenal/jejunal motor function consistent with the duodenal brake mechanism

High‐resolution manometric studies below the stomach are rare due to technical limitations of traditional manometry catheters. Consequently, specific motor patterns and their impact on gastric and small bowel function are not well understood. High‐resolution manometry was used to record fed‐state motor patterns in the antro‐jejunal segment and relate these to fasting motor function.
